The Eighth State Central Working Committee of the Sangha held its first-day session of the seventh meeting at Maha Pasana Cave on Thiri Mingala Kaba Aye Hill in Mayangon Township, Yangon Region, yesterday morning.
Union Minister for Religious Affairs and Culture U Tin Oo Lwin offered cash for nine prerequisites and Myanmar version books on Parittas, Sutta and Desana preached by the Lord Buddha to State Ovadacariya Sayadaws, members of the State Sangha Maha Nayaka Committee and members of the State Central Working Committee of the Sangha.
The meeting was presided over by Chairman of the SSMNC Aggamaha Pandita Aggamaha Saddhammajotikadhaja Dr Bhaddanta Candima Bhivamsa while Joint Secretary Sayadaw Aggamaha Ganthavacaka Pandita Aggamaha Saddhammajotikadhaja Bhaddanta Paññajota acted as master of ceremonies.
The meeting participants listened to Ovadakatha of State Ovadacariya Sayadaws.
At the meeting, the Chairman Sayadaw delivered a Saraniya Ovadakatha. The Union Minister for Religious Affairs and Culture supplicated religious affairs, set records on numbers of State Ovadacariya Sayadaws, SSMNC member Sayadaws and SCWCS member Sayadaws who passed away within a year from Tabaung of 1385 ME to date and sought the approval for the list of elected State Ovadacariya Sayadaws, SSMNC member Sayadaws and members of SCWCS.
Secretary of SSMNC Aggamaha Pandita Aggamaha Saddhammajotikadhaja Mahadhammakathika Bahujanahitadhara Bhaddanta Vasettha Bhivamsa supplicated a brief report of the SSMNC on its work process within a year to the meeting.
Aggamaha Pandita Bhaddanta Siha, Aggamaha Pandita Bhaddanta Kovida and Aggamaha Pandita Dr Bhaddanta Suriya read the Vinicchaya, religious and educational sectors in the one-year report of the SSMNC.
Meeting participant members of the Sangha were served day meals by U Thein Maung-Daw Pa Pa of Sandi traditional medicine family from 240, Konzaytan Street, Yangon.
The meeting was also attended by Yangon Region Chief Minister U Soe Thein, Yangon Region ministers, departmental heads, the pro-rector (Admin) of International Theravada Buddhist Missionary University and officials.
